He is about to take part in his first Extra-Vehicular Activity [EVA], performing maintenance outside the Space Station to upgrade its batteries to newer lithium-ion versions. Intensive preparations for this procedure took place in the months leading up to launch, with classroom sessions at NASA\u2019s Johnson Space Centre in conjunction with underwater training in NASA\u2019s Neutral Buoyancy Lab.<\/p>\n","protected":false},"excerpt":{"rendered":"<p><img loading=\"lazy\" decoding=\"async\" src=\"http:\/\/www.esa.int\/var\/esa\/storage\/images\/esa_multimedia\/videos\/2017\/01\/thomas_pesquet_-_eva_preparations\/16589488-2-eng-GB\/Thomas_Pesquet_-_EVA_preparations_small.jpg\" width=\"170\" height=\"96\" align=\"left\" hspace=\"8\"><\/p>\n<p>\nThomas Pesquet from France has been on-board the ISS since 19 November 2016.
